Muslim American Women in Sports: Constraints, Challenges, and Empowerment

Abstract

There is a lack of scholarship on sporting culture for Muslim American women. In the United States, Muslim institutions, including mosques and community centers, encourage young men to play sports in order to assimilate to American culture by providing sporting spaces on their premise (Thangaraj, 2015). Young Muslim women are often explicitly excluded from these spaces, left to pursue sports on their own time. These young Muslim American women use their bodies in sports to claim power in different spaces to challenge racializations and gendered stereotypes tied to Muslim bodies and gendered expectations within the Muslim communities.
